ford Motor Company has recently announced a significant shake-up in its European management team, marking a power shift towards the United States. This move comes as part of ford's ongoing efforts to streamline operations and strengthen its global footprint.
The decision to restructure the European management team is aimed at aligning the company's operations with its global strategy. By bringing key decision-makers closer to its headquarters in the United States, ford aims to improve collaboration and responsiveness to market demands.
The reshuffling of leadership positions will involve several high-profile changes within the company. Steven Armstrong, the current head of ford Europe, will be returning to the United States to take on a new role as the chairman of ford's Europe, Middle East, and Africa operations. Stuart Rowley, the current chief operating officer of ford North America, will fill the vacant position of president for ford Europe.
This power shift signifies ford's commitment to driving growth and profitability in Europe, a market that has recently faced several challenges, including Brexit uncertainties and a declining demand for diesel vehicles. By realigning its leadership structure, ford aims to navigate these challenges effectively and position itself for long-term success.
With this move, ford also hopes to leverage its global resources and expertise to drive innovation and accelerate the development of electric and autonomous vehicles in Europe. The company has already made significant investments in electric vehicle production facilities in the region and intends to further expand its presence in the growing market for electric mobility.
